- Данные можно взять с сайта openweathermap.org или с любого другого сервиса.
- Обязательно использовать react.js и redux или любой другой продпочительный для вас аналог.
- Добавлять/удалять города
- Сохранять локально данные
- Автоматически запрашивать погоду по координатам пользователя - это город/место по умолчанию.
- Результат разработки должен быть выложен на github с подробными коммитами.
- Приветствуется внешнее оформление, оригинальность, демонстрация скилов.
- Огромным плюсом будут юнит тесты + приемочные тесты с использованием puppeteer
- Можно использовать любой скелетон для проекта (тут воля вашей технической фантазии).
- Использовать все что может сократить время разработки, приветствуется.
- Можно использовать любой сет компонентов (к примеру Material-UI и так далее).